Preserve Hokarsar Wetland but don’t harass proprietary landholders: Apni Party

SRINAGAR:  Apni Party Senior Vice President Ghulam Hassan Mir on Friday called for protection and preservation of Hokarsar wetland but simultaneously urged the wild-life department not to cause any kind of inconvenience to the proprietary land owners in Soibugh and its adjacent areas.

Earlier a delegation comprising of proprietary land owners from Soibugh, Daharmuna, Wadwan, Gotpura and adjacent areas called on Mir at Apni Party Office in Lal Chowk Srinagar wherein they made a representation on their grievances with regard to preservation plan of Hokersar Wetland subject, a party spokesman said.

He said that the delegation apprised Apni Party Senior Vice President that despite bringing the issue in the notice of wild life department officers they are being unnecessarily harassed and intimidated by the department’s field officials who under the garb of retrieving the wetland area are trying to forcibly evict the genuine owners of the proprietary land from their land holdings.

The delegation also pleaded that a number of poor farmers have been slapped with FIRs by the wildlife department only because they refused to leave their proprietary land. The delegates added that all the aggrieved farmers who are being harassed by the wildlife department have proper revenue records for their land holdings in the Hokersar area.

Assuring the delegation of its full support Apni Party Senior Vice President urged the Lt Governor Manoj Sinha to intervene into the matter on priority so as to redress the grievances of the agitating proprietary land holders in Soibugh and its adjacent hamlets.

Mir also asked the wildlife department to refrain from unnecessary harassment and forcible eviction drive in the area till the grievances of the agitating farmers are redressed.
